- [ ] Confirm the stale-cache fix from the Larkspur postmortem is included in this release. The invalidation logic in the Pinemere cache layer must now respect upstream version headers. QA has signed off on staging. Before approving, the release manager should cross-check that the deployed artifact matches the verified build token below.

trace token, fafog-kageg: htk4_98e6

Handover: ProctorQ exam queue (Veldan Systems). Queue drains via three workers; if lag exceeds 5 min, restart worker-2 first — it leaks sockets. Do not purge the dead-letter topic during exam windows; reprocess after 22:00. Mira owns escalations this week. Dashboard alerts route to the support rotation. If the admin console locks you out during an incident, use the break-glass account; its recovery passphrase is on the line below.

unlock words, yawig-kagef: gordor-holvan-ulaael-pramir-ulaiel-tamdor

Ticket #— Floor 9 Opening Prep, Brindlemoor House

Hi facilities folks, Floor 9 opens to staff next Monday and we need a few things squared away before then. Lift access is live, but the two side doors by the kitchenette are still on the old lock config — please reprogram them before Friday. Also, signage for the quiet rooms hasn't arrived, so pop up the temporary printed ones for now. Until the badge readers sync, the interim door code for Floor 9 is below.

door code, bajop-bajog: bdg-DSWAC-43621